[Keyboard] PCB Ruler updates (#6584)
* Move default keymap's rules to keyboard level * Concatenate the two sets of rules This sets CONSOLE_ENABLE to no, which was being set at the keymap level. * Wrap the USB Device Description in quotes Some preventative maintenance. The firmware for the_ruler can't be compiled without this change if `CONSOLE_ENABLE = yes` because this string has a comma, which gets picked up as two arguments by the Command code, instead of one as it should be. * Linting - remove firmware size impacts - remove trailing white space - visual alignment of rules * Use QMK's pre-loaded default rules for atmega32u4 * Update readme - markdown formatting - update Hardware Availability link (Maple Computing's site has disappeared) - update Docs links * Update header files to use #pragma once
